THE JEWS' WHO'S WHO
Especially rare British anti-Semitic book, 'The Jews' Who's Who', compiled by Henry Hamilton Beamish (London: The Judaic Publishing Co.), 1920. Pictorial double-page front endpapers. 8vo, 255 pp.; publisher's red cloth titled on front, spine and rear covers, binding a bit rubbed, rear end-papers with inner hinge repaired. With the ink stamp of seller Beamish on title page, two ownership signatures within. First edition of this especially rare compilation regarding Jewish influence on global politics and economy, mainly promoting as fact that Jews are gaining control over the British economy. It contains a chronological description of 'The Jew Conquest of England', and a list of Jewish economists which includes their supposed income. Other chapters are titled 'Our Jew-dominated Press', 'Honored Jews and Titled Aliens', 'Jew Conquerors of France', etc. Henry Hamilton Beamish (1893-1948) was an Irish-born leading British anti-Semite. He founded 'The Britons' as a propaganda organization and became involved in local politics on an anti-immigrant platform. He was among the earliest developers of the Madagascar Plan for Jewish deportation to Palestine and claimed to have influenced Adolf Hitler. For a time he served as Vice-President of the Imperial Fascist League. He settled in Southern Rhodesia but was eventually interned for his pro-Nazi sentiments.
